Have now played 6 rounds with arccos, they were scrambles so I didn’t save them but the data they show is awesome and highly recommend
tell me more, I am curious how practical is the product and would the sensors hold up to wear and tear? And essentially the system tracks every shot and provides analytics and then eventually tips on the course?
Not sure why they would wear and tear except on the bottom of the bag so that should be fine. and yes it tracks shots and the more you use it the more in depth it will get. It can show you SG data for all parts of the game and help figure out what you need to improve, give true yardages and suggest clubs based on wind/elevation changes etc

Appreciate the insight sir how about range shots, assume you can just delete that data? And it would not be able to measure distance on range would it? Distance would have to be based on traveling to the next shot
Doesn’t do range shots. It measure distances by sounds, so you hit walk to your ball and then when you hit again it stops the old measurement and starts a new one.
